Книга: Платформа J2Me

Глава 1. Знакомство с платформой Java 2 Micro Edition (J2ME)

Глава 1. Знакомство с платформой Java 2 Micro Edition (J2ME)

Компания «Sun Microsystems» определяет три платформы Java, каждая из которых отвечает нуждам различных компьютерных сред:

— Java 2 Standard Edition (J2SE);

— Java 2 Enterprise Edition (J2EE);

— Java 2 Micro Edition (J2ME).

Исходной точкой разработки платформы J2ME послужила необходимость определения компьютерной платформы, которая бы могла послужить основой для электронных и встраиваемых устройств массового потребления. Эти устройства иногда называются портативными устройствами.

Создатели платформы J2ME разделяют портативные устройства на две отдельные категории:

— Персональные мобильные информационные устройства, которые способны к нестационарным сетевым коммуникациям — мобильные телефоны, двусторонние пейджеры, персональные информационные устройства («карманные компьютеры») и органайзеры.

— Информационные устройства с общим соединением, подсоединенные к фиксированному беспрерывному сетевому соединению — компьютерные приставки к телевизору, телевизоры с выходом в Интернет, телефоны с дисплеем и возможностью выхода в Интернет, коммуникаторы высокого класса, развлекательные и навигационные автомобильные системы.

Первая категория описывает устройства, которые имеют специальное назначение илг ограничены в функциях, они не являются универсальными вычислительными машин ми. Вторая категория описывает устройства, которые обычно имеют большие возможности для средств пользовательского интерфейса (UI). Конечно, устройства с более совершенными средствами пользовательского интерфейса обычно имеют большую пьютерную мощность. На практике компьютерная мощность является первостепенным атрибутом, отличающим эти две категории устройств. Тем не менее, это разграничение является немного неясным, поскольку технология дает возможность все большие и большие мощности размещать во все более и более мелких устройствах.

Как и компьютерная мощность, связь — наличие таких средств, как беспроводные сети, — также влияет на виды функциональных возможностей и служб, которые могут поддерживать портативные устройства. Задача — и первостепенная цель — для J2ME заключается в установлении платформы, которая может поддерживать разумный набор служб для широкого спектра устройств, имеющих широкий диапазон различных возможностей.

Создатели J2ME определяют в качестве ключевого механизма модульное построение, которое дает возможность поддерживать множество типов устройств. Разработчики J2ME используют для создания 12МЕ-модуля конфигурации и профили.

Оглавление книги


Генерация: 2.520. Запросов К БД/Cache: 3 / 1
поделиться
Вверх Вниз